Huun-Huur-Tu

The remote region of Tuva, among the new countries formed using the dissolution from the U.S.S.R., provides produced among the world’s most uncommon vocal groupings, Huun-Huur-Tu. Masters from the throat performing design of xoomei, when a vocalist creates several notes concurrently, the group continues to be warmly by a global following. Based on Jazz Moments, “a rustic joyousness and unadulterated expresiveness emerge from these music artists”. Analyzing Huun-Huur-Tu’s music, The Chicago Tribune, composed, ‘it is new yet very available, an other-worldly but deeply religious music that’s rooted within the audio of character”. Dirty Linen had taken a similar watch, declaring, “this music is certainly both very religious and right down to globe, grounded in a solid feeling of place, however its appeal is certainly universal.” Furthermore to recording their very own albums, the associates of Huun-Huur-Tu possess contributed their particular vocals to albums and/or shows by Frank Zappa, The Chieftains, Johnny “Electric guitar” Watson, The Kronos Quartet and L. Shankar and Ry Cooder’s soundtrack from the film, Geronimo. Their on-going cooperation with Angelite, the Bulgarian Woman’s Choir beneath the path of Mikhail Alperin, provides yielded two unforgettable albums — Journey, Journey My Sadness in 1994 and Hill Story in 1998. Although its name translates actually as “sunlight propeller”, Huun-Huur-Tu represents a lot more. Inside a 1994 interview, founding percussionist Alexander Bapa described, “(the name of the music group identifies) the vertical seperation of light rays which are frequently seen within the grasslands soon after sunrise or simply before sunset”. In the beginning called “Kungurtuk”, Huun-Huur-Tu arrived collectively, in 1992, to try out “the aged and forgotten tunes”. Founding users Sasha and Sayan Bapa and Kaigalool Khovalyg experienced previously performed a state-sanctioned ensemble through the Soviet routine. Although Tuvan music acquired typically been performed by way of a solo vocalist or instrumentalist, the group audio of Huun-Huur-Tu established them aside. Huun-Huur-Tu provides experienced several workers changes. First member Anatoli Kuular still left to form a fresh music group, Yat-Kha, in past due 1993, and was changed by Anatoli Kuular, a get good at from the borbangnadyr design of performing along with a virtuosic participant from the mouth area harp (xomuz) and byzanchi. Percussionist Alexander Bapa still left, in 1995, to become manufacturer in Moscow, and was changed by Alexander Siraglar, a sygyt vocalist, string participant and precussionist.
